"Stop smoking. This is the single most important factor in preventing a further heart attack."

The article I'm reading also suggests other factors to prevent heart attacks. Why does it use "single" here?

I think the author is saying that, although there are other preventative measures that can be taken to reduce the risk of a heart attack, the most important one is to stop smoking.
